Transaction eda3096831042161a404fe45c9c424c755b2161b1e061547fa32900e4d05fa53
1 Input
1 Output
-
eda3096831042161a404fe45c9c424c755b2161b1e061547fa32900e4d05fa53:0
- value
- 969883
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f237e7e57bf79ed85378e6acf9c25cbde3bcd1e
- address
- bc1qtu3huljhhau7mpfh3e4vl8p9e00rhng76mmxah